Understanding Wagering Requirements

Wagering requirements, often referred to as playthrough requirements, dictate the amount of money a player must wager before being able to withdraw any winnings earned from a bonus.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means that a player must wager 30 times the bonus amount before being eligible for a withdrawal. This requirement is designed to prevent players from simply claiming a bonus and immediately withdrawing the funds. It's crucial to carefully read the terms and conditions of any bonus to understand the specific wagering requirements and ensure they are realistic and achievable. Ignoring these requirements can lead to frustration and potentially the forfeiture of bonus funds.

The Importance of Payment Methods and Security

A seamless and secure payment process is a fundamental requirement for any online gaming platform. Players need to be confident that their financial transactions are protected and that they have access to a variety of convenient payment options. Popular payment methods typically include credit cards (Visa, Mastercard), e-wallets (PayPal, Skrill, Neteller), bank transfers, and increasingly, cryptocurrency options. The platform should employ robust encryption technology, such as SSL, to protect sensitive financial information during transmission. Furthermore, adherence to industry regulatory standards, such as PCI DSS compliance, is crucial for maintaining a secure payment environment.

Ensuring Secure Transactions

Beyond encryption, platforms should also implement fraud prevention measures to detect and prevent unauthorized transactions. This may include multi-factor authentication, IP address tracking, and regular security audits. The availability of a clear and concise privacy policy is also essential, outlining how player data is collected, stored, and used. Reputable platforms will prioritize player security and transparency, providing a safe and trustworthy gaming experience. Prompt and efficient withdrawal processing is an additional indicator of a platform’s reliability and commitment to customer satisfaction. A transparent and speedy payout system builds trust.

Regulatory Compliance and Licensing

Operating an online gaming platform legally requires obtaining licenses from reputable regulatory authorities. These licenses ensure that the platform adheres to strict standards of fairness, security, and responsible gaming. Licensing jurisdictions include Malta Gaming Authority, UK Gambling Commission, and Curacao eGaming. The presence of a valid license is a strong indicator of a platform’s credibility and trustworthiness. Players can typically find information about a platform’s licensing details in the footer of the website or in the "About Us" section. It is crucial to verify the validity of the license with the issuing authority before depositing any funds or engaging in real-money gameplay.
